Sticking or Jammed Locks
Symptoms:
Difficulty turning the keyKey gets stuckLock feels stiff
Repair Steps:
Lubrication: Apply a graphite-based lubricant to the keyhole and key mechanism. Avoid oil-based lubes, which can bring in dirt.Adjustment: Check if the door or lock is misaligned. Adjust the screws or hinge positioning as necessary.Cleansing: Remove dirt and particles from the lock cylinder using compressed air or a clean fabric.2. Loose or Wobbly Knobs and Handles
Symptoms:
Knobs or deals with fall out of locationExcessive motion when turning
Repair Steps:
Tightening Screws: Using a screwdriver, tighten up the screws that hold the knob or deal with in place.Replacing Washers: If components are worn, think about changing washers or internal components specific to the lock type.3. Broken Key Issues
Signs:
A key becomes stuck within the lockThe key breaks off in the cylinder
Repair Steps:
Retrieval: If a key breaks off, utilize a pair of needle-nose pliers to thoroughly extract the piece from the lock.Key Replacement: For seriously harmed keys, obtain a duplicate or rekey the lock to make sure security.4. Misaligned Locks
Symptoms:
The door does not close properlyLatch does not engage with the strike plate
Repair Steps:
Adjust Hinges: Use a screwdriver to tighten up or rearrange hinges.Realign Strike Plate: If the latch bolt does not associate the strike plate, consider moving the plate somewhat to accommodate the lock.5. Smart Lock Malfunctions
Symptoms:
Lock stops working to react to keypads or smart device appsConnection concerns
Repair Steps:
Battery Check: Replace the batteries within the smart lock if it reveals indications of power failure.Software Update: Check for firmware or software updates through the lock manufacturer's application.Preventive Maintenance Tips
Maintaining door locks can lengthen their life-span and lower the probability of breakdowns. Think about the following ideas for efficient lock upkeep:
Regular Lubrication: Apply graphite-based lubricant every 6 months to keep internal parts moving efficiently.Examine Regularly: Periodically inspect locks for any indications of wear, misalignment, or damage.Secure Against Weather: For outside locks, think about using weather-resistant locks and make sure that they are frequently cleaned to eliminate severe components.FAQ Section1. How typically should I change my door locks?
It is recommended to change your door locks whenever you move into a new home, experience a break-in, or your existing locks reveal significant wear. Regular inspections can also direct timely replacement.
2. What can I do if my lock is frozen throughout winter season?
Utilize a lock de-icer that is particularly created for this situation. Applying heat (like a hair dryer) might also assist, however beware of damaging the lock.
3. Can I repair a lock myself?
Lots of small lock problems such as lubrication, tightening screws, and adjustment can be resolved DIY. However, if the issue is extreme or requires a lock rekeying, expert help might be needed.
4. When should I call a locksmith?
If your attempts to repair the lock fail or if you discover yourself locked out, it is best to seek advice from a professional locksmith for support.
